General description
Magisglow 30 is a high sensitivity water-washable fluorescent penetrant. It can be used in a wide range of applications, guaranteeing excellent penetration characteristics and excellent reliability in detecting surface open defects. This liquid penetrant is also ideal for checking welding defects such as holes/porosities, as its high penetration capability reduces inspection time and allows the detection of small defects.

Product Properties
Appearance  | Yellow-green  | 
Type / Method  | Type 1 / Method A  | 
Sensitivity  | Level 4  | 
User Recommendations
NDT Method  | Water washable fluorescent liquid penetrant inspection  | 
Usage temperature  | From 4°C to 52°C ASTM E165/UNI EN ISO 3452-1  | 
Preliminary cleaning  | Velnet/Solnet  | 
Recommended penetration time*  | From 10 to 20 min.  | 
Developer  | Rotrivel U − Velcontrast Dry Powder − Rotrivel H2O Paste  | 
Final cleaning  | Water – Velnet/Solnet – Detergent H2O  | 
Shelf life  | 3 years at T between 5°C and 45°C, in a dry place safe from direct sunlight  | 
Accessories EN ISO 3452  | Reference block type 1 Reference block type 2  | 
* The times indicated refer to working temperatures between 10 and 52°C, for temperatures between 4 and 10°C the times indicated must be doubled.
